Italy Probes Meta for Alleged €870 Million in Unpaid VAT (1)

Feb. 22, 2023, 4:47 PM UTC

Milan prosecutors are investigating Facebook parent company Meta Platforms Inc. for alleged unpaid VAT taxes for a total of about €870 million ($927 million), according to people familiar with the matter.

The investigation, originally led by Italy’s Guardia di Finanza finance police, is focused on the years 2015 to 2021, the people said, asking not to be named discussing private information.
